FP2: Yet another Mercedes 1-2

Mercedes once again dominated, the Red Bulls looked in good shape and Caterham had a dramatic session in FP2 at Hockenheim on Friday. With the track temperatures reaching 58 degrees Celsius - the hottest so far this season - the on-track action also heated up as the Mercedes duo of Lewis Hamilton and Nico Rosberg again too fast for their rivals. Rosberg had the upper hand in the first session, but Hamilton topped the log in the afternoon as the times dropped after drivers switched to the supersofts.
